return 0; } -static int mobiveil_pcie_probe(struct platform_device *pdev) +int mobiveil_pcie_host_probe(struct mobiveil_pcie *pcie)This is no longer static - but do you need to add a header file somewhere?
The function mobiveil_pcie_probe() is still static below, the mobiveil_pcie_host_probe() is new introduced one, it is now only used in this .c file, so I'll change it to a static function in v10.
